Four-star safety Trey Dean keeps top teams in suspense with another commitment delay

Where will he end up?

Trey Dean says he's not ready to decide.

That's what he told 247Sports Sunday morning when the 4-star cornerback dropped this bomb — he's not ready to decide which school he'll attend.

Dean said he wants to concentrate on his senior season. "I will be taking more visits and making that decision on a college when I feel the time is right," he told 247.

Dean, who has more than 50 division one offers, said he would make his decision on July 31, but that's on hold now. The 6'2, 180 pound, class of 2018 recruit seems to be deciding between South Carolina, Georgia and Alabama, with the 247 Crystal Ball giving the Gamecocks the best shot (40%).

Dean is ranked as the No. 21-ranked defensive back prospect in the country, and the No. 28 rated prospect in the state of Georgia.
